Formerly known as Bistro du Nord, the owner P. Laurent has re-invented the decor, food, and ambiance, creating a delightfully modern Parisian style bistro, "Le Paris." The menu offers new and improved dishes as well as the previous three course Pre-Theater Menu, served 5-7p.m. daily.
The classic bistro fare includes duck confit, moules marinieres, steak tartar, grilled black angus au poivre, Kobe burger, lamb shank, calf liver, oysters, as well as a tempting fromage du jour and a large selection of wines by the glass or bottle at very reasonable prices. In addition, you can prepare your own fish or meat dishes, "simply done" with a choice of sauce and garnitures. At "Le Paris" you will feel transported to a romantic riverside table in Paris, complete with strains of music francaise and twinkling candlelight - a truly memorable dinning experience.
